How to Get a Locksmith for a Car

Every driver has been in a situation of being locked out of their vehicle. It can happen at any possible time - while at the pump at the grocery store, or when you are heading home after a long workday.

Locksmiths are equipped with tools and expertise to help you get your vehicle back on the road, without creating any damage. They can open the doors or trunk and give you a keys for a fresh set.

1. Slim Jim

The most common name is "slim jim" the tool is a must-have for any locksmith who offers automotive services. It is typically a long piece of steel that can fit between the door and window to hold the locking mechanism inside of the car. It is also an effective method for an auto locksmith to unlock cars without the key.

Professional locksmiths be able to use the tool properly so as not to harm the vehicle. It is crucial to select the correct tool because the wrong one can cause the car to lock itself and pose danger for the driver and Elsycrays.Top other passengers.

A locksmith could also use other tools to assist you gain access to your vehicle. They could use lockscrews or wedges. A wedge is put in to create a barrier between the window and the weather stripping. A wire can be put through the gap to get access to the locking mechanism. A lock pick is similar to a slim jim but requires more skill and Elsycrays (www.elsycrays.Top) knowledge.

A lock pick is more difficult to use, however it can be very efficient in certain scenarios. If you have an older car with the switch lock that a lockpick can unlock, a lockpick can do it by pressing the switch. However it's not recommended that you use a lockpick on modern vehicles since they are equipped with VATS passcode detectors which are designed to ward off these types of attacks. Therefore, it's best to leave these methods to a locksmith that is specialized in automobiles.

3. Immobilizer

A locksmith is able to repair or replace the chip that controls your transponder inside your car key, allowing you to begin your vehicle. They can also reprogram your immobilizer system to ensure that no one else is able to steal your vehicle. They can give your car an extremely secure environment and can often reduce your insurance premiums.

Immobilizers are an extremely popular anti-theft device, and they are now mandatory in many EU countries. They function by sending radio signals through the transponder, and then checking that it recognises them. The ECU will shut down the ignition circuit when it receives the signal. Additionally, the car will show an indicator light on the dashboard that shows "car-with-key" or similar symbols.

5. Identification

It can be a hassle and exhausting to get back into your car if you have lost your keys or locked them inside. With a locksmith on call you can get back in quickly and easily.

Auto locksmiths can be of assistance when you are having issues with the ignition cylinder or switch. They can identify and correct these issues to get your car back on the road in no time.

A locksmith for automotive needs to verify your identity before they are able to perform any work. They will need a driver's license with the address of your home or office that matches the address from which you require services. They'll also need to see your vehicle's registration and title or proof of insurance. In addition to these documents, you'll need to provide a picture ID to verify that you are the owner of the vehicle or property in question.
